Interview with Aḥmad ‘Abd al-Raḥmān Abū ‘Adas
Biography: | The interview was recorded on December 13, 2003 with Aḥmad ‘Abd al-Raḥmān Abū ‘Adas, male, born in 1924 in al-Mujaydil, Palestine. He worked with the Police during the British Mandate. |
